Prohibition Against Using Penalty Envelopes and Limited Use of Postal Service Equipment

Do not mail your complaint in a penalty envelope printed with the official mail emblem to avoid payment of postage. If you do, you may be subject to a $300 fine.

Any use of Postal Service computers or office equipment such as photocopiers or facsimile machines to prepare or send EEO complaint documents must comply with the Postal Service policy concerning the limited personal use of office equipment and technology.
